Avalanche (AVAX) remains under pressure as its price hovers near its lowest level since November 2023, trading at $13.78. Despite nearing a significant milestone of burning 5 million tokens, valued at over $68 million, the token has slumped by 90% from its all-time high. Technical analysis suggests further downside potential, with the price recently dropping below key support levels. The network's burn mechanism, which incinerates on-chain fees, has not significantly impacted AVAX's price due to daily token unlocks that increase circulating supply. Avalanche's transactions have surged, with 65 million recorded in the last 30 days, surpassing Ethereum's 54 million. The upcoming launch of a spot AVAX ETF by Grayscale could potentially boost demand, although historical data shows mixed results for altcoin ETFs.
